You could tuck your fan leaves if you don't feel comfortable with defol. You might feel a little better about it when the time comes to clean it up. My usual defol is about 4-6 big fans lol, some little kling on's on the lower stem.. and that's after tucking is no longer effective. A good defol is typically a balancing act. You want light to get in. Pest homesteading minimal, but at the same time those leaves are very useful to the plant until the last few weeks. A plant stripped to just buds will have troubles snapping out of Ph lock and other issues. You'll want to leave enough to be sort of an insurance policy. :)

k so did some research and looks like foliar spray is fine for autos, at least from what I found. also read it's a good way to quickly fix a deficiency so decided to go that route. I made it a little strong with 2 tsp in a gal, also small splash of insect soap. sprayed them with an atomizer at 6.5 ph and made sure to get the underside of the leaves good. did this couple hours after lights out and at 72 degrees, heard they absorb better at that temp.

there also appears to be some nutes burn on lower leaves that got stuck in the soil. some leaves turning yellow and dying on the bottom as well. read the yellowing ones are likely the plant using them for flowering or because they aren't getting enough light and not to worry. just going to hope it's normal and see if it gets worse by next watering.:Namaste:

If they need it, feed it. I start at 1/2 and move up slowly. Sometimes, like my Berry Bomb, I miss the timing of flower and she gets all deficient on me. I'm currently feed her at 1.5 x recommend feeding. If she don't burn, she gets more feed next time.
